Arclinea Boston Wins Watermark Award for Contemporary Kitchens

BOSTON, Mass. -- Arclinea Boston, the Italian kitchen design showroom, has won a Watermark Grand Award for kitchens it designed for D4, the luxury condominium development in Boston's South End. Produced by BUILDER and Custom Home magazines, the Watermark Awards honor excellence in kitchen and bath design. Jurors for this year's competition reviewed nearly 150 entries.

NevaSlip Floor Treatment is Perfect for Green Building

LYNN, Mass. -- Independent laboratory testing of the formula that NevaSlip(TM) anti-slip floor service uses to make architectural stone and tile floors slip resistant shows it to be 100% environmentally safe, even as it gives those floors a Static Coefficient of Friction (SCOF) rating that meets or exceeds current federal ADA regulations.

Patent Pending Insulated Electrical Box from IBC Expected to be Incorporated Into New Homes

BREVARD, N.C. -- Insulation Business Consultants announced today that the firm has developed a means of maintaining the thermal integrity of exterior walls, eliminating the voids in the insulation where electrical boxes (switch and receptacle boxes), create significant holes in the residential thermal envelope.
